With the SCAL software you can cut any of the fonts that you have on your computer including dingbats etc, you can also make your own designs in inkscape and import them into the SCAL software, you can weld the letters together, you can create a shadow (which I haven't found that you can once you have welded with the CDS(Official cricut software)). There is also a forum where people are uploading their designs, so you can use them too.
The CDS software (cricut design studio) is the software where all the cartridges are listed, unfortunately you can only cut the cartridges that you own as it asks you to insert the cartridge before it starts cutting. As said earlier once you weld letters together I haven't found a way of making a shadow for it, although you can do individual shadows with single letters, the same as with the machine.
